Recent Price Performance and Benchmark Comparison
Standard Capital Markets Ltd’s stock has underperformed significantly against the broader market benchmark, the Sensex, over the past year and year-to-date periods. While the Sensex has delivered positive returns of 5.59% over one year and 8.25% year-to-date, the stock has declined sharply by 49.00% and 46.87% respectively over the same intervals. This stark contrast highlights the stock’s vulnerability amid broader market resilience.
In the short term, the stock’s one-week performance shows a steep fall of 7.27%, compared to a marginal 0.10% decline in the Sensex. However, over the last month, the stock has managed a modest gain of 2.00%, slightly outperforming the Sensex’s 0.45% rise. Despite this, the recent downward trend has overshadowed any short-term gains, signalling persistent selling pressure.
Technical Indicators and Investor Behaviour
The stock is currently trading below all key moving averages, including the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day averages. This technical positioning suggests a bearish trend, often interpreted by traders as a signal to reduce exposure or avoid new positions. The consecutive three-day decline has resulted in a cumulative loss of 10.53%, reinforcing the negative sentiment among market participants.
Investor participation has also waned, as evidenced by a 31.09% drop in delivery volume on 24 Nov compared to the five-day average. The delivery volume stood at 30.47 lakh shares, indicating reduced conviction among buyers and sellers alike. Lower delivery volumes often point to diminished enthusiasm and can exacerbate price declines when selling pressure persists.

Liquidity and Trading Considerations
Despite the recent price weakness, Standard Capital Markets Ltd remains sufficiently liquid for trading, with the stock’s traded value supporting a trade size of approximately ₹0.01 crore based on 2% of the five-day average traded value. This liquidity ensures that investors can enter or exit positions without significant market impact, although the prevailing negative trend may deter new buyers.
The stock’s long-term performance, however, tells a different story. Over three and five years, it has delivered exceptional returns of 148.18% and 1033.33% respectively, far outpacing the Sensex’s 35.79% and 93.00% gains. This historical outperformance indicates that the current weakness may be a cyclical correction rather than a structural decline, but the near-term outlook remains cautious.

Summary and Outlook
The decline in Standard Capital Markets Ltd’s share price on 25 Nov is primarily attributable to a combination of technical weakness, reduced investor participation, and underperformance relative to the broader market. The stock’s position below all major moving averages signals a bearish trend, while the three-day consecutive fall and significant delivery volume drop highlight waning investor confidence.
While the stock’s long-term track record remains impressive, the current environment suggests caution for investors. The underperformance against the Sensex over the past year and year-to-date periods underscores the challenges faced by the company’s shares in the near term. Market participants should monitor trading volumes and technical indicators closely to gauge any potential reversal or further deterioration in price momentum.
In conclusion, the recent price fall in Standard Capital Markets Ltd reflects a confluence of technical and market sentiment factors rather than fundamental shifts, emphasising the importance of a measured approach when considering exposure to this stock.
